Learn inside of concepts before referring to the tax rate to avoid confusion and potential errors in your computation. Generally you need to find out is your taxable income. Get the result of one's income for that year without having the allowable deductions, exemptions, and adjustments come across your taxable income. Based during the resulting taxable income, you is able to find the applicable income level along with the corresponding tax bracket. The rate on your tax is presented in percentage appear.
